Plyometric Training: Power Skip Routine Drill

·1 min read

This plyometric drill is a power skip routine, used for sprinters and jumpers. This drill teaches an athlete to become coordinated in the swinging motion of their arms and to focus on driving the knee to parallel on the front side of each skip. The athlete should have the foot strike the ground directly under their center of mass, propelling them up and forward.
